My fabulous clients just returned from their Virgin Voyages Greek Island Cruise and wanted to share!

Hi Amanda,

Here's a breakdown:

Athens - The Electra Palace Hotel was awesome! It was centrally located and there were great views of the Acropolis from our rooms and from the restaurant. The morning breakfasts were also high quality. The concierge was a great help of recommending things for us.

We wanted to try authentic Gyros and they suggested Greco's Project https://www.grecosproject.gr/en/ and it did not disappoint. 1 minute walking and there were a lot of locals there so that was good.

On Saturday we did the Red Bus on/off and traveled the City, which was great. We then got off to do the Acropolis, however the tickets were sold out. However, we were able to go to the Acropolis Museum which was awesome! It actually sits above an archeology site.

Santorini - We did a wine tasting excursion through Virgin as the kids suggested it. The tour itself was great, we toured 2 wineries and our guide was great...wine was okay but we also live 30 minutes from Napa LOL!
Part of the excursion is to have free time in Oeia and Fira which was good. Crowded but we expected that.
They gave us tram tickets to take down to the port...unfortunately, there were 3 other cruise ships there so we had to wait a little over an hour to get on the tram...not too bad, just hot.

Rhodes - We did a 5 hour Kayak excursion through Virgin that included snorkling time. After that we regrouped at the shipped and walked through Ancients Rhodes visiting the Palace of the Grand Master: https://palaceofthegrandmaster.com/ worth it if you like history...both Gunner and Tabitha were really into it!

Bodrum - We "freelanced" there and went to the Bodrum Castle, which was doing some underwater archeology and we were able to see some scientists picture and catalog some items! https://www.bodrum-museum.com/
Had some great seafood at the port.
The only thing about Bodrum is that a lot of the restaurant people were "hawking" to get you to go their restaurant...annoying.

Seaday - Spent all day at the pool, eating, drinking, playing games, napping, repeat!

Mykonos - We went to Super Paradise Beach Thalas for about 5 hours, water was a little colder than Rhodes but we had fun relaxing and having authentic Greek food there.

Mykonos - Saturday and the girls were shopping, of course, but I asked the local guy there where is a good seafood place to eat and he suggested Kavos.
It was still on the waterfront and again it did not disappoint!

We stayed the night in Mykonos and the kids went back into town for the nightlife....Kim and I stayed and watched fireworks from our balcony! Apparently there was a wedding.

There was a lot of moving parts on this trip but EVERYTHING went according to plan (except for the passport machines breaking down in Athens!). Thank goodness we didn't have a connecting flight as some passengers did.

Our rooms on the ship were great, centrally located easy access to the galley and great views going into port. However, we were right below the galley so every morning at around 0700, you can hear tables and chairs being dragged on the floor above, which of course woke us and the kids up.
